Output e0526f66832563ac2477cde10f688fa7e7dbd4e13fbdbeeb41bcf4d77979f5b0:0

value
176260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057259ed88a309d66490d1136bcf4061655e5a76 OP_EQUAL
address
32BpHmZn3VoufqpK7cYFujHX3wz6wkqhtw
transaction
e0526f66832563ac2477cde10f688fa7e7dbd4e13fbdbeeb41bcf4d77979f5b0
spent
true